TICKET-4417: Vault locked during profile-store resharding

Migrating Nimbello user-profile store from 4 to 16 shards. Cutover script rotated the shard-map vault key mid-run; vault is now sealed and writers are queued. Reads unaffected. Need security review sign-off before unseal. Rollback not viable — shard 9 already dual-writing. Blast radius: profile edits only. Unseal procedure is standard; operator at the console will need the recovery passphrase below.

strongbox words: sorir-belvan-rusix-ulays-ralmir-praix-eliir-tamax-praael-druael-julir-tamius-jorir

### 2.8.1 — Renamed RESOLVER_RETRY to DNS_RETRY_BUDGET

The old name confused folks during the flaky-resolution saga on the Mossbridge cluster, so we renamed it. Same semantics, clearer intent. While updating your env file, note the resolver telemetry exporter also needs its upload credential, which goes on the very next line.

sealed setting: ARCHIVE_KEY3=8d0

## v4.3.0 — Pagination rework

The Lanternly public REST API now uses cursor-based pagination everywhere; `page` and `offset` params are deprecated but still accepted until v5. If you're on call and see a spike in 400s, it's probably a client sending a stale cursor after the TTL — the runbook has the fix. Rollback is a config flag, not a redeploy. Escalations go to the person below.

named custodian: Brivan Eliath Quenox Frador